Role Description The Head of Investor Relations | USA Market to support our UK, EU & Asian Market teams and will lead all investor-facing engagement and strategy for MARV at the Pre-Seed Level activities related to the United States market. This hybrid role is based in the London Area, United Kingdom, with the flexibility to work partly from home. Day-to-day responsibilities include developing and delivering investor presentations, managing relationships with prospective investors, and coordinating regular updates on performance, strategy, and milestones.
The role will oversee the preparation of financial and market analysis to support investment narratives, collaborate with leadership on fundraising initiatives, and ensure consistent, compliant messaging across all investor touchpoints. The Head of Investor Relations will also monitor market trends, investor sentiment, and competitive landscapes to inform leadership and refine communications strategy.
